How they compare
Qatar currently reports 0.9663 approx. -2.5 to +2.5 against 0.94 approx. -2.5 to +2.5 in Mauritius, a difference of 0.0263 approx. -2.5 to +2.5.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Mauritius ahead.
Globally, Mauritius ranks 38th and Qatar ranks 36th of 204 countries.

About this data
Regulatory Quality (RQ) captures perceptions of the government’s ability to design and implement policies and regulations that promote private sector development. Governance estimate from the aggregation model, in units of a standard normal distribution, i.e. ranging from approximately -2.5 to 2.5. Larger values correspond to better governance. The (country-series-time) metadata include the (a) number of sources, and (b) standard error. The number of sources indicates the number of underlying data sources on which the governance estimate is based. The standard error indicates the precision of the governance estimate. Larger values indicate less precise estimates. A 90% confidence interval for the governance estimate is given by the estimate +/- 1.64 times the standard error.
